Point Cloud Plugin


Point Cloud Plugin v0.6](http://pointcloudplugin.com)
Release Notes

New Features / Improvements

  • Efficient GPU streaming, allowing support for huge data sets (1 billion and more)
  • Dramatically decreased VRAM requirements (under 100MB per cloud in most cases)
  • Significantly decreased RAM requirements (upwards of 50%)
  • Rendering uses point-budgeting to maintain stable FPS at all times, regardless of cloud size
  • Added support for Eye-Dome Lighting technique
  • Much improved import times
  • Duplicate points detection
  • Import works in asynchronous manner
  • Support for importing multiple clouds concurrently
  • Dynamic sprite size adjustment
  • Option to allocate higher quality towards the center of the screen
  • Improved and simplified UI
  • Simplified Custom Materials
  • Better Blueprint exposure
  • Support for UE4.23
  • Support for multiple instances of the same cloud
  • Set of **runtime Point Selection **functions to help query the data inside the cloud
  • Efficient runtime Insertion and Removal of points
  • Rendering settings work on per-component basis now, rather than per-asset
  • Switching between Points and Sprites no longer requires rebuilding
  • Per-project plugin settings
  • STAT PointCloud for easier profiling
  • Point Cloud Exporting
  • Code is more coherent, understandable and with better documentation

Fixes

  • Fixed several stability issues and crashes
  • Fixed import precision issues
  • Fixed occasional incorrect switching of Render Method upon reimport
  • Fixed issues with releasing rendering resources
  • Fixed many LOD related issues

Other Changes

  • Plugin now requires Shader Model 5 compatible graphics card
  • Removed support for Low Precision rendering, as the VRAM requirements are no longer an issue. This will improve shader recompilation times
